About The Ceiba Restaurant (Safari World)
The Ceiba Restaurant is the flagship culinary brand of Safari World, West Africa’s first-of-its-kind eco-tourism, lifestyle, and amusement destination. Operating across Dawu, Ada, and Accra, The Ceiba Restaurant delivers a premium farm-to-table dining experience built on sustainability, innovation, and culinary excellence.
With a strict NO MSG policy, over 70% of ingredients sourced directly from Safari Farms, and an average of 10,500 guests served weekly, The Ceiba Restaurant is redefining fine dining, banqueting, and hospitality standards in Ghana.

Job Description and Requirements
Key Responsibilities
Prepare, produce, and present a wide range of pastries, desserts, baked goods, and specialty confections to the highest quality standards.
Develop and maintain innovative dessert menus aligned with The Ceiba Restaurant’s premium brand and farm-to-table philosophy.
Ensure strict adherence to the restaurant’s NO MSG policy, food quality standards, and presentation guidelines.
Supervise and train junior pastry staff, ensuring consistency in recipes, portioning, and plating.
Manage daily pastry kitchen operations, including production planning, workflow coordination, and service readiness.
Monitor ingredient quality, freshness, and storage, ensuring proper stock rotation and minimal waste.
Support menu development for banquets, events, and seasonal offerings.
Maintain full compliance with food safety, hygiene, and sanitation standards (HACCP).
Collaborate closely with Executive Chefs, Sous Chefs, and service teams to ensure timely dessert service and exceptional guest experiences.
Assist with inventory management, cost control, and efficient use of resources within the pastry section.
Requirements
Professional qualification in Pastry Arts, Baking, or Culinary Arts from a recognized institution.
Minimum 4–6 years of professional pastry or baking experience, with exposure to high-volume or fine dining operations.
Strong expertise in dessert production, baked goods, chocolate work, plating, and modern pastry techniques.
Solid knowledge of food safety, hygiene, and kitchen best practices (HACCP).
Creative flair with strong attention to detail, consistency, and presentation.
Ability to manage time effectively in a fast-paced kitchen environment.
Strong teamwork, communication, and leadership potential.
High level of professionalism, passion for quality, and commitment to excellence.
